Sun public observation during the ESAC Fun Run
The CESAR team set up the solar telescopes for a public observation of the Sun during the ESAC Fun Run on the 11 October 2013. The Fun Run is a yearly social and charity race at the ESAC (European Space Astronomy Center) premises in Madrid.

About 40 people could enjoy the views of the active Sun through the H-alpha and visible filters. At sunset the team removed the visible filter from the front of the white-light telescope, so that the audience could also enjoy the views of Venus (close to Quadrature) during daylight. The observations finished at 23:00 local time.
